Mediation offers a comprehensive and participating procedure for attending to conflicts and locating equally agreeable services. At its core, it is an assisted in conversation entailing all parties to the problem, assisted by a neutral and impartial arbitrator. Unlike adversarial approaches-- where one side "wins" at the expense of the various other-- arbitration intends to reveal common rate of interests and co-create options that fulfill the needs of everybody entailed. Each arbitration session typically lasts from 2 to five hours, relying on the topics being discussed. In more complex situations, numerous sessions might be needed, prolonging the overall duration.
